The effectiveness of electrospinning as a simple approach to disperse POSS into a polymer matrix at a nm‐level has been assessed. Electrospun and cast films were prepared by dissolving CA and epoxycyclohexylisobutyl POSS in the solvent mixture acetone/DMAc. The membranes were characterized by SEM, TEM and WAXD. Whereas films produced by casting showed µm‐sized POSS crystals, thus suggesting a small affinity between the polymer matrix and the POSS molecules, those prepared by electrospinning were characterized by a nanometric POSS distribution. This is explained by considering the peculiar solvent evaporation mechanism, occurring during the electrospinning process, which allows to produce nanofibers characterized by a silsesquioxane dispersion similar to that present in solution.

The Alternaria toxins alternariol (AOH; 3,7,9-trihydroxy-1-methyl-6H-benzo[c]chromen-6-one) and alternariol methyl ether (AME, 3,7-dihydroxy-9-methoxy-1-methyl-6H-benzo[c]chromen-6-one) are common contaminants of food and feed, but their oxidative metabolism in mammals is as yet unknown. We have therefore incubated AME and AOH with microsomes from rat, human, and porcine liver and analyzed the microsomal metabolites with HPLC and GC-MS/MS. Seven oxidative metabolites of AME and five of AOH were detected. Their chemical structures were derived from their mass spectra using deuterated trimethylsilyl (TMS) derivatives, and from the information obtained from enzymatic methylation. Several of the metabolites were identified by comparison with synthetic reference compounds. AME as well as AOH were monohydroxylated at each of the four possible aromatic carbon atoms and also at the methyl group. In addition, AME was demethylated to AOH and dihydroxylated to a small extent. As the four metabolites arising through aromatic hydroxylation of AME and AOH are either catechols or hydroquinones, the oxidative metabolism of these mycotoxins may be of toxicological significance.  相似文献

The proportion of sustainable property in the total building stock remains small. One reason is that the financial added value resulting from sustainability is not sufficiently taken into account in property valuation due to the tendency of valuations to lag behind market trends. Quantitative information is provided to integrate those aspects of sustainability relating to value into valuations and thereby contribute to the reduction of valuation lag. The Centre for Corporate Responsibility and Sustainability (CCRS) Economic Sustainability Indicator (ESI) measures the risk of property to lose value and the opportunity to gain value due to future developments (e.g. climate change or rising energy prices). Five groups of value-related sustainability features were identified: flexibility and polyvalence; energy and water dependency; accessibility and mobility; security; and health and comfort. By minimizing the risk of loss in value through future developments, those sustainability features contribute to the property value. Their effects on property value were quantified by risk modelling. As an indicator for future-oriented property risk, the ESI is integrated into the discount rate of discounted cash flow valuations. The approach was tested for plausibility and practicability on more than 200 properties.

La proportion de biens immobiliers durables dans le parc immobilier total demeure faible. L'explication tient pour une part au fait que la valeur ajoutée financière résultant de la durabilité n'est pas suffisamment prise en compte dans l'évaluation des biens immobiliers en raison du fait que les évaluations tendent à avoir du retard sur les tendances du marché. Des informations quantitatives sont fournies afin d'intégrer les aspects de la durabilité liés à la valeur dans les évaluations et de contribuer ainsi à la réduction du retard dans les évaluations. L'Indicateur de Durabilité Economique (ESI) du Centre pour la Responsabilité et la Durabilité en Entreprise (CCRS) mesure le risque de perte de valeur des biens immobiliers et la possibilité d'en accroître la valeur du fait des évolutions futures (par ex. changement climatique et hausse des prix énergétiques). Cinq groupes de fonctions de durabilité liées à la valeur ont été identifiés: flexibilité et polyvalence, dépendance vis-à-vis de l'énergie et de l'eau; accessibilité et mobilité; sécurité; santé et confort. En minimisant le risque d'une perte de valeur causée par les évolutions futures, ces fonctions de durabilité contribuent à la valeur des biens immobiliers. Leurs effets sur la valeur des biens immobiliers ont été quantifiés par une modélisation des risques. En tant qu'indicateur du risque prospectif pour les biens immobiliers, l'ESI est intégré au taux d'actualisation des flux de trésorerie actualisés. Cette approche a été testée quant à sa plausibilité et sa praticabilité sur plus de 200 biens immobiliers.

Objective: Marital discord has been linked to both depression and anxiety; however, our understanding of how marriage contributes to the development of internalizing symptoms is limited in scope and lacking specificity. First, it is unclear whether the marital relationship contributes to the broad dimension of internalizing symptoms as opposed to specific diagnoses. Second, it is unclear how the marital relationship contributes to internalizing symptoms: through global marital dissatisfaction or through specific relationship processes (and which processes). The purpose of the present study was to address these 2 issues and, more generally, to develop a comprehensive and refined framework within which to understand the role of marriage in the developmental course of internalizing symptoms. Method: Questionnaire and interview data were collected from 102 husbands and wives 5 times over the first 7 years of marriage. Results: Results indicated that marital discord during the transition into marriage was associated with the broad dimension of internalizing symptoms for husbands but not for wives. Further, both global marital dissatisfaction and an imbalance of power and control put husbands at significant risk for symptoms over the first 7 years of marriage, whereas low levels of emotional intimacy put wives at significant risk. Conclusions: Results exemplify the need to routinely consider intimate relationship processes in etiological models of depression and anxiety and to identify specific clinical targets that can be prioritized in interventions aimed at preventing internalizing disorders. Pineal gland melatonin is the darkness hormone, while extra-pineal melatonin produced by the gonads, gut, retina, and immune competent cells acts as a paracrine or autocrine mediator. The well-known immunomodulatory effect of melatonin is observed either as an endocrine, a paracrine or an autocrine response. In mammals, nuclear translocation of nuclear factor κ-light-chain-enhancer of activated B cells (NF-κB) blocks noradrenaline-induced melatonin synthesis in pinealocytes, which induces melatonin synthesis in macrophages. In addition, melatonin reduces NF-κB activation in pinealocytes and immune competent cells. Therefore, pathogen- or danger-associated molecular patterns transiently switch the synthesis of melatonin from pinealocytes to immune competent cells, and as the response progresses melatonin inhibition of NF-κB activity leads these cells to a more quiescent state. The opposite effect of NF-κB in pinealocytes and immune competent cells is due to different NF-κB dimers recruited in each phase of the defense response. This coordinated shift of the source of melatonin driven by NF-κB is called the immune-pineal axis. Finally, we discuss how this concept might be relevant to a better understanding of pathological conditions with impaired melatonin rhythms and hope it opens new horizons for the research of side effects of melatonin-based therapies.  相似文献

Particulate-filled composites were prepared from CaCO 3 and polymer matrices of various acid-base characters. Interfacial interaction of the components was characterized by the reversible work of adhesion, which was calculated either from dipole-dipole or acid-base interactions. The thickness of the spontaneously formed interlayer was derived from the tensile strength of the composites. The results proved that acid-base interactions play an important role in interphase formation. The strength of interfacial adhesion is determined by the joint effect of dispersion forces and acid-base interactions. Stronger interaction leads to a thicker interphase with decreased mobility. Treatment of CaCO 3 with an aliphatic fatty acid leads to a decrease in the strength of interaction, and to changes both in the thickness and properties of the interphase. In composites containing coated fillers, acid-base interactions influence composite properties less due to the neutral character of the surface.  相似文献

A comprehensive evolutionary personality psychology can be developed by identifying individual differences within each of the evolved systems that regulate social behaviour. We developed a questionnaire measure of social rank style, defined as individual differences in preferred strategies for pursuing, defending, and, when necessary, relinquishing social rank. The 17-item Rank Style with Peers Questionnaire (RSPQ) comprises three nearly independent scales: dominant leadership, coalition-building, and ruthless self-advancement. A series of studies demonstrated that: (a) the RSPQ’s, factor structure is robust; (b) the three rank style variables are not redundant with the five-factor traits or adult attachment styles; (c) they are related in theoretically expected ways to adjustment outcomes, to agentic and communal interpersonal behaviours, and to social reputations; (d) they predict group and individual performance outcomes relevant to organisational psychology; and (e) they are related in theoretically expected ways to psychopathology, including social anxiety disorder and depressive symptoms. Future directions for research on social rank styles and prospects for an evolutionary personality psychology are discussed. (PsycINFO Database Record (c) 2010 APA, all rights reserved)  相似文献

The identification of both approved and non-approved genetically modified organisms (GMOs) is an integral part of GMO biosafety legislation in many countries. One aspect that may affect PCR-based detection of a GMO lies within the analysis of its genetic stability, as sequence alterations or DNA instabilities may impede quantification by PCR. Genetic stability can be analyzed using various methods, yet many of these methods have distinct disadvantages, including low sensitivity. In this study, high resolution melting (HRM) analysis and real-time PCR with Scorpion primers were used as a method to analyze the 3′ end of RR soybeans (RR 40-3-2) in a large number of samples (n = 1,034). No evidence for the occurrence of mutation events was found, implying that the nucleotide sequence of this region is unlikely to be unstable and is well suited as a target for the quantification of RR soybeans. Additionally, and as a preparative work for an optimization of the method, a 174 bp region of the first intron of the Adh1 gene was analyzed in several varieties of maize with different GMO events using the same approach. The results show that 2 alleles are present. In further experiments, the different alleles were cloned into plasmids to generate homozygous plasmids from heterozygous templates in order to generate for a more precise analysis. The overall methodological aim of these studies was to compare HRM analysis with Scorpion primer PCR. Both methods were capable of differentiating between the 2 homozygous and heterozygous alleles. For a better discrimination, however, we conclude that it is most reliable to consider the results of both methods. This dual approach is assumed to be an effective tool as an accurate, high-throughput means of the screening of GMOs for potential genetic instabilities that may interfere with the detection and identification of specific GM events.  相似文献

This article discusses the evaluation of flashing yellow as an off-peak traffic signal control strategy by establishing an interface between a real-time traffic simulation software HUTSIM (Helsinki University of Technology Simulation Model) and a standard NEMA (National Electrical Manufacturers Association) traffic signal controller. The analysis was performed as part of research dealing with evaluation of different off-peak traffic signal operation strategies and their relative impacts on delay, fuel consumption, vehicle emissions, and driver safety. Because of its widespread use, the main emphasis was on the flashing yellow signal control. Delay field study was performed to obtain and analyze real-world data and compare the efficiency of flashing yellow and fixed time control strategies. To widen the research effort and eliminate inaccuracies due to certain assumptions made during the field study, computer simulation was chosen as an effective tool for comparison of different control strategies. Four different strategies were evaluated: fixed time, fully and semiactuated, and flashing yellow. Flashing yellow was found to be the most efficient of the signal strategies. The impact of this type of off-peak signal control on driver safety also was studied, and a summary of results is presented.  相似文献
